Artists, galleries and festivals are leaving Miami's former art mecca for more culturally rich neighborhoods.

When Tony Goldman, one of the driving forces behind Manhattan’s SoHo district transformation, saw potential in the working-class neighborhood of Wynwood, Miami, in the early 2000s, he set the district on the fast track to revival.
